Лекція 11. Служби MS SQL Server
3. Служба Microsoft Search
Служба Microsoft Search
Служба Microsoft Search (MSSearch), також називана Full-Text Search, використається для пошуку символьної інформації в таблицях баз даних SQL Server 2000. Архітектура й принципи роботи системи пошуку в SQL Server 2000 були істотно перероблені в порівнянні з попередніми версіями. Служба Microsoft Search дозволяє виконувати повнотекстовий пошук (full-text search). Технологія повнотекстового пошуку дозволяє знаходити не тільки слова і фрази, ідентичні зазначеним, але й близькі до них за змістом і написанням. Після виконання пошуку користувач одержить результуючий набір, що містить відмінювані форми дієслів і іменників.
Технологія повнотекстового пошуку активно впроваджується корпорацією Microsoft в усі свої продукти. Наприклад, в Microsoft Internet Information Server є компонент Index Server, що виконує повнотекстовий пошук на HTML-сторінках. Для реалізації повнотекстового пошуку в SQL Server 2000 існують повнотекстові каталоги (full-text catalog) і повнотекстові індекси (full-text index).
Дані повнотекстових каталогів і індексів зберігаються окремо від основних даних у спеціальних файлах. Всі дії по роботі із цими файлами здійснює служба MSSearch. Зв'язок між службами MSSQLServer і MSSearch виробляється через спеціального постачальника (full-text provider).
Служба MSSearch періодично аналізує зміст таблиць баз даних і обновляє (repopulation) повнотекстові каталоги й індекси. Якщо необхідно створити повнотекстовий індекс заново, варто виконати перебудування (rebuild) індексу. Результатом такого підходу є те, що даними повнотекстового пошуку потрібно управляти окремо від основних даних. Адміністратор повинен настроїти інтервали відновлення даних повнотекстового пошуку. Крім того, операції резервного копіювання й відновлення файлів повнотекстового пошуку необхідно виконувати окремо від основних даних.
( Зауваження )
Служба MSSearch може функціонувати тільки як служба Windows NT і працювати тільки під керуванням операційної системи Windows NT Server. Наслідком цього обмеження є неможливість установки служби повнотекстового пошуку в редакції SQL Server Desktop Engine. Служба MSSearch установлюється тільки для редакцій SQL Server Standard Edition і SQL Server Enterprise Edition. Проте, будь-які клієнти, включаючи клієнтів Windows 95/98 і Windows NT Workstation, мають можливість звертатися із запитами на повнотекстовий пошук до серверам із установленою службою MSSearch.
Шрифти
Розмір шрифта
Колір тексту
Колір тла
Кернінг шрифтів
Видимість картинок
Інтервал між літерами
Висота рядка
Виділити посилання
Вирівнювання тексту
Ширина абзацу